PENGARUH LEVERAGE, LIKUIDITAS, DAN UKURAN PERUSAHAAN TERHADAP NILAI PERUSAHAAN
Abstract
This research aimed to examine the effect of leverage, liquidity, and firm size on the firm value of Food and Beverage compan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ange (IDX). Moreover, leverage was measured by DER (Debt to Equity Ratio), liquidity was measured by CR (Current Ratio), firm size was measured by Size, and firm value was measured by PBV (Price to Book Value). The research was quantitative, which was presented by a number and analysis method that used SPSS (Statistical Product and Service Solution). Furthermore, the data were in the form of a table; to ease understanding and analyze more systematically. The population was Food and Beverage compan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ange (IDX). Additionally, the data collection technique used purposive sampling, with 20 companies as the sample. The data were taken for 3 years (2020-2022). In total, there were 60 data samples analyzed. In addition, the data analysis technique used multiple linear regression. The results of the study indicate that the leverage variable with a proxy (DER) has a positive effect on company value. Liquidity with a proxy (CR) has a negative effect on company value. Company size with a proxy (Size) has a positive effect on company value.
